INTERNSHIP DETAILS

Intern - Software Engineer, HBM

CompanyMicron Technology
LocationRichardson
Work ModeOn Site
PostedDecember 18, 2025
Internship Information
Core Responsibilities
Build reliable, scalable data services and front-end applications. Design and operate ETL/ELT pipelines and RESTful APIs.
Internship Type
full time
Company Size
35057
Visa Sponsorship
No
Language
English
Working Hours
40 hours
Apply Now →

You'll be redirected to
the company's application page

About The Company
Micron is an industry leader in innovative memory and storage solutions transforming how the world uses information to enrich life for all. With a relentless focus on our customers, technology leadership, and manufacturing and operational excellence, Micron delivers a rich portfolio of high-performance DRAM, NAND and NOR memory and storage products through our Micron® and Crucial® brands. Every day, the innovations that our people create fuel the data economy, enabling advances in artificial intelligence (AI) and compute-intensive applications that unleash opportunities — from the data center to the intelligent edge and across the client and mobile user experience. To learn more about Micron Technology, Inc. (Nasdaq: MU), visit micron.com.
About the Role
Build reliable, scalable data services and front-end applications. Design and operate ETL/ELT pipelines and RESTful APIs. Develop front-end applications using modern frameworks to visualize data. Collaborate with business analysts and product managers to clarify requirements. Document designs, write README notes, and follow secure coding practices. Pursuing an M.S. in Computer Science, Electrical Engineering, Computer Engineering, Data Science, or related field; B.S. already completed. Solid understanding of CS fundamentals including data structures, algorithms, complexity, and basic networking. Ability to solve straightforward problems with guidance and work independently on assigned tasks. Familiarity with the software development lifecycle, coding standards, source control, and build pipelines. Awareness of secure coding hygiene and IP protection expectations. Experience with Python, JavaScript, Node.js, or C# (.NET) in team projects. Familiarity with Docker, cloud platforms (AWS/Azure/GCP), and observability tools. Understanding of authentication protocols (OAuth2/OIDC/JWT) and secure coding practices. For front-end focused candidates: proficiency in TypeScript and React. Knowledge of web fundamentals (HTML5, CSS3), responsive layouts, accessibility, and performance optimization (e.g., Core Web Vitals).
Key Skills
PythonJavaScriptNode.jsC#ETLELTRESTful APIsFront-End DevelopmentTypeScriptReactHTML5CSS3DockerAWSAzureGCP
Categories
TechnologySoftwareData & AnalyticsEngineering